### Changelog — StormRelay fan-out defaults (v3.8)

Heads up, future maintainers: we changed the default fan-out behavior for weather alerts. The old defaults dated back to when StormRelay served one county; now that the Halverton region is on board, the per-shard batch size and retry backoff were starving low-priority advisories. We also flipped dedup to fingerprint-based, which cut duplicate push alerts by a lot. Nothing else moved, promise. The new defaults shipped in this release are below.

deployment values, yadug-bawif:
[framir]
team = pelox
access_code = ac_a38ab2
owner = tamion.julael
host = framir.tolvaqlabs.test
port = 11211
peer = tammir.zemvargrid.local
salt = 2215ef03
pin = 1541

**Vendor note: Inkmill markdown pipeline**

Rendering for Parchway docs is outsourced to Inkmill under an annual contract, renewing each March. They handle sanitization and PDF export; we own the upload queue. SLA: 4-hour response on rendering failures. Escalate only after two failed retries. Their support desk is reachable at the address below.

billing contact of hahaf-baguf = zorael.tammir.jorius@sivrelhq.internal

Subject: DR drill notes — schema registry piece

Hey — quick heads-up for your review before Friday's drill at Tindermere. We'll simulate losing the Quillstack event schema registry and restoring from the cold replica. Consumers pin schema versions, so nothing should break, but please eyeball the restore permissions. The restore job won't start without operator auth; when prompted during the drill, the operator enters the recovery passphrase below.

unlock words, yadup-yagef: zorael-druix